Deep Space Rendezvous
Date (UTC) | Spacecraft | Event | Remarks |
---|---|---|---|
9 January | Mars Express | Flyby of Phobos | Closest approach: 100 kilometres (62 mi). Mars Express made a total of 8 flybys of Phobos at a distance of less than 1,400 kilometres (870 mi) between 20 December and 16 January. |
9 January | Artemis P1 | Spacecraft left LL2 orbit and joined Artemis P2 in LL1 orbit | |
11 January | Cassini | 3rd flyby of Rhea | Closest approach: 76 kilometres (47 mi) |
15 February | Stardust (NExT) | Flyby of Tempel 1 | Closest approach: 181 kilometres (112 mi). Observed changes since Deep Impact flyby and imaged crater created by Deep Impact impactor, as well as new terrain. |
18 February | Cassini | 74th flyby of Titan | Closest approach: 3,651 kilometres (2,269 mi) |
18 March | MESSENGER | Mercurocentric orbit injection | First artificial satellite of Mercury; elliptical orbit with a periapsis of 200 kilometers (120 mi) and an apoapsis of 15,000 km (9,300 mi). |
19 April | Cassini | 75th flyby of Titan | Closest approach: 10,053 kilometres (6,247 mi) |
8 May | Cassini | 76th flyby of Titan | Closest approach: 1,873 kilometres (1,164 mi) |
8 June | Chang'e 2 | Departed lunar orbit | Travelled to L2 Lagrangian point, which it reached in August 2011. |
20 June | Cassini | 77th flyby of Titan | Closest approach: 1,359 kilometres (844 mi) |
27 June | Artemis P1 | Lunar orbit insertion | Initial orbital parameters were: apogee 3,543 kilometres (2,202 mi), perigee 27,000 kilometres (17,000 mi). Over the following three months, the orbit was lowered to an apogee of 97 kilometres (60 mi) and a perigee of 18,000 kilometres (11,000 mi), with an inclination of 20 degrees; retrograde orbit. |
16 July | Dawn | Vestiocentric orbit injection | First artificial satellite of 4 Vesta. Initial orbit was 16,000 kilometres (9,900 mi) high and was reduced to 2,700 kilometres (1,700 mi) until 11 August. |
17 July | Artemis P2 | Lunar orbit insertion | Initial orbital parameters were similar to Artemis P1. Over the following three months the orbit was lowered to an apogee of 97 kilometres (60 mi) and a perigee of 18,000 kilometres (11,000 mi), with an inclination of 20 degrees; prograde orbit. |
25 August | Cassini | Second-closest flyby of Hyperion | Closest approach: 25,000 kilometres (16,000 mi) |
12 September | Cassini | 78th flyby of Titan | Closest approach: 5,821 kilometres (3,617 mi) |
16 September | Cassini | Flyby of Hyperion | Closest approach: 58,000 kilometres (36,000 mi) |
1 October | Cassini | 14th flyby of Enceladus | Closest approach: 99 kilometres (62 mi) |
19 October | Cassini | 15th flyby of Enceladus | Closest approach: 1,231 kilometres (765 mi) |
6 November | Cassini | 16th flyby of Enceladus | Closest approach: 496 kilometres (308 mi) |
12 December | Cassini | 3rd flyby of Dione | Closest approach: 99 kilometres (62 mi) |
13 December | Cassini | 79th flyby of Titan | Closest approach: 3,586 kilometres (2,228 mi) |
31 December | GRAIL-A | Lunar orbit insertion | Twin satellite Grail-B's insertion occurred a day later, on 1 January 2012. |
